Kochi: The High Court Thursday refused to expunge remarks made by it against top cop T P Senkumar in connection with a forest case involving actor Kalabhavan Mani.
Dismissing the petition filed by jail DGP Senkumar seeking to expunge the adverse remarks made earlier, Justice B Kemal Pasha said the earlier order was not liable to be interferred with.
The High Court also directed the registry to forward a copy of the order to the state chief secretary.
Earlier, the Court had made remarks against Senkumar while considering a petition filed by two forest officials seeking to quash a case registered against them.
While he was intelligence ADGP, Senkumar had reportedly spoken in support of the actor who was allegedly involved in the forest case.
